Abstract

A system and method for delivering digital subscriber line (DSL) service to a subscriber from a remote terminal of a telephone network. Included is a first route for delivering a telephone signal to the subscriber, and a second route for passing the telephone signal through a DSL system before delivering the signal to the subscriber. A disruptor is then used to selectively activate either the first or second route.

Claims (42)

1. A method of delivering digital subscriber line (DSL) service to a subscriber, comprising the steps of:

(a) attaching a first end of a first connection ( 20 b / 22 b ) to a connect block ( 20 / 22 ) at a first terminal on said block ( 20 / 22 ) where a pair gain signal is selectively received;

(b) attaching a second end of said first connection ( 20 b / 22 b ) to an input of a splitter ( 50 ), said splitter selectively receiving a DSL signal;

(c) attaching a first end of a second connection ( 50 a ) to said connect block ( 20 / 22 ) at a second terminal on said block ( 20 / 22 ) where said pair gain signal is selectively relayed to the subscriber ( 30 );

(d) attaching a second end of said second connection ( 50 a ) to an output of said splitter ( 50 ); and

(e) disrupting a signal path running through said connect block ( 20 / 22 ) between said first terminal and said second terminal so as to cause said pair gain signal to be diverted into said splitter ( 50 ) through said first connection ( 20 b / 22 b ).

2. The method of delivering digital subscriber line service according to claim 1 , wherein said disruption of said signal path includes an insertion of a disconnect plug ( 24 ) into said connect block ( 20 / 22 ).

3. The method of delivering digital subscriber line service according to claim 1 , wherein said connect block 20 / 22 is an insulation displacement connection (IDC) block.

4. The method of delivering digital subscriber line service according to claim 1 , wherein no noticeable disruption of telephone service occurs.

5. The method of delivering digital subscriber line service according to claim 1 , wherein DSL service can be stopped by removing the disruption of said signal path and then removing the first connection ( 20 b / 22 b ) and second connection ( 50 a ).

6. The method of delivering digital subscriber line service according to claim 5 , wherein no noticeable disruption of telephone service occurs during the stopping of DSL service.

7. A system for delivering digital subscriber line (DSL) service to a subscriber, comprising:

(a) a pair gain system ( 10 ) for generating a pair gain signal;

(b) a cross connect block ( 20 / 22 ) for selectively receiving one or more connections;

(c) a splitter ( 50 ) for combining and separating signals, wherein one of said signals is a DSL signal from a DSL system ( 40 );

(d) a first route for communicating said pair gain signal from said pair gain system ( 10 ), through said cross connect block ( 20 / 22 ), to said subscriber ( 30 ), and vice versa;

(e) a second route, partially overlapping said first route, for communicating said pair gain signal from said pair gain system ( 10 ), through said splitter ( 50 ), to said subscriber ( 30 ), and vice versa; and

(f) a disruptor for selectively activating one of said first and second routes.
